python读取txt文件并逐行输出字符串

 更新时间:2023年10月06日 14:32:19   作者:mob649e8153b214  
Python提供了简单且方便的方法来读取txt文件,使用open()函数和readlines()方法逐行输出文件中的字符串内容,我们可以轻松地读取文件内容,并通过循环遍历的方式逐行处理,读取txt文件的方法在各种应用场景中非常常见,可以用于数据分析、文本处理、日志分析等

在日常的编程工作中,我们经常需要读取文本文件中的内容。Python作为一种强大的编程语言,提供了丰富的库和方法来处理文件操作。本文将介绍如何使用Python读取txt文件,并逐行输出文件中的字符串内容。

Python读取txt文件的方法

Python提供了多种方法来读取txt文件。我们常用的方法是使用内置的open()函数来打开一个文件,并使用readlines()方法逐行读取文件内容。

以下是读取txt文件并输出每一行的示例代码:

with open('file.txt', 'r') as file:
    lines = file.readlines()
    for line in lines:
        print(line.strip())

在上述代码中,open('file.txt', 'r')打开了一个名为file.txt的文件,并以只读模式('r')进行操作。readlines()方法用于将文件内容按行读取,并返回一个包含所有行的列表。然后,我们使用循环遍历列表中的每一行,使用print()函数输出每一行的内容。strip()方法用于去除每一行开头和结尾的空格或换行符。

请注意,上述示例中的file.txt是一个虚拟的文件名,你需要根据实际情况将其替换为你要读取的txt文件的路径和文件名。

示例应用场景

读取txt文件的方法在实际应用中非常常见。以下是一些示例应用场景:

  1.     数据分析:读取包含数据的文本文件,进行数据清洗、处理和分析。
  2.     文本处理:读取文本文件,进行字符串处理、文本挖掘等操作。
  3.     日志分析:读取日志文件,统计和分析日志信息。
  4.     配置文件读取:读取配置文件中的参数,进行程序配置。
     

总结

Python提供了简单且方便的方法来读取txt文件,并逐行输出文件中的字符串内容。通过使用open()函数和readlines()方法,我们可以轻松地读取文件内容,并通过循环遍历的方式逐行处理。读取txt文件的方法在各种应用场景中非常常见,可以用于数据分析、文本处理、日志分析等任务。希望本文对你理解和应用Python读取txt文件有所帮助。

到此这篇关于python读取txt文件并逐行输出字符串的文章就介绍到这了,更多相关python读取txt文件内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• Python类的继承用法示例

    Python类的继承用法示例

    这篇文章主要介绍了Python类的继承用法,结合实例形式分析了Python类的定义、继承等相关操作技巧,需要的朋友可以参考下
    2019-01-01
  • Python本地及虚拟解释器配置过程解析

    Python本地及虚拟解释器配置过程解析

    这篇文章主要介绍了Python本地及虚拟解释器配置过程解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2020-10-10
  • 使用Python快乐学数学Github万星神器Manim简介

    使用Python快乐学数学Github万星神器Manim简介

    这篇文章主要介绍了使用Python快乐学数学Github万星神器Manim简介,本文给大家介绍的非常详细,具有一定的参考借鉴价值,需要的朋友可以参考下
    2019-08-08
  • springboot整合单机缓存ehcache的实现

    springboot整合单机缓存ehcache的实现

    本文主要介绍了springboot整合单机缓存ehcache的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2023-02-02
  • 用Python每天自动给女友免费发短信

    用Python每天自动给女友免费发短信

    大家好,本篇文章主要讲的是用Python每天自动给女友免费发短信,感兴趣的同学赶快来看一看吧,对你有帮助的话记得收藏一下,方便下次浏览
    2021-12-12
  • 深入探讨Python中的异常处理及最佳实践

    深入探讨Python中的异常处理及最佳实践

    异常处理是编写健壮、可靠和易于调试的Python代码中不可或缺的一部分,在本文中,我们将深入探讨Python中的异常处理机制,并分享一些最佳实践和代码示例,希望对大家有所帮助
    2025-11-11
  • Python使用struct处理二进制的实例详解

    Python使用struct处理二进制的实例详解

    这篇文章主要介绍了Python使用struct处理二进制的实例详解的相关资料,希望通过本文大家能掌握这部分内容,需要的朋友可以参考下
    2017-09-09
  • Python 中 Elias Delta 编码详情

    Python 中 Elias Delta 编码详情

    这篇文章主要介绍了Python 中 Elias Delta 编码,下面的文章我们将使用 python 实现 Elias Delta 编码。具体详细内容,需要的朋友可以参考一下
    2021-11-11
  • Django配置MySQL数据库的完整步骤

    Django配置MySQL数据库的完整步骤

    这篇文章主要给大家介绍了关于Django配置MySQL数据库的完整步骤,文中通过示例代码介绍的非常详细,对大家学习或者使用django具有一定的参考学习价值,需要的朋友们下面来一起学习学习吧
    2019-09-09
  • 安装Python和pygame及相应的环境变量配置(图文教程)

    安装Python和pygame及相应的环境变量配置(图文教程)

    下面小编就为大家带来一篇安装Python和pygame及相应的环境变量配置(图文教程)。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
    2017-06-06

最新评论